Understanding the Fundamentals of Online Casino Games
Online casino games encompass a vast spectrum of options, each with its own unique rules, strategies, and potential payouts. Classic table games like blackjack, roulette, and baccarat remain incredibly popular, attracting players with their strategic depth and social interaction. Blackjack, for example, involves skill and decision-making, where players aim to beat the dealer without exceeding 21. Roulette relies on chance, with players betting on where a ball will land on a spinning wheel. Baccarat, often associated with high rollers, is a relatively simple game with a focus on predicting the winning hand. These games are available in various formats, including live dealer versions that simulate a real-world casino experience with a human dealer streamed in real-time.
The Rise of Online Slot Games
Alongside table games, online slot games have exploded in popularity, becoming a dominant force in the online gaming industry. These digital versions of traditional slot machines offer a wide array of themes, features, and jackpot opportunities. From classic fruit machines to sophisticated video slots with intricate storylines and bonus rounds, there's a slot game to suit every preference. The appeal of slot games lies in their simplicity, accessibility, and the potential for significant wins. Understanding the mechanics of slot games, such as paylines, volatility, and return to player (RTP) percentages, can enhance the gaming experience and improve chances of success.
| Game Type | House Edge (Average) | Skill Level | Popularity |
|---|---|---|---|
| Blackjack | 0.5% – 1% | High | Very High |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low | High |
| Baccarat | 1.06% (Banker Bet) | Low | Medium |
| Online Slots | 2% – 10% | Very Low | Extremely High |
The table above provides a general overview of the house edge associated with common online casino games. Understanding the house edge, which represents the casino's advantage, is crucial for making informed betting decisions. Remember that these are average figures, and the actual house edge can vary depending on the specific game and casino.

Key Features of a Secure Gaming Platform
Beyond licensing and security, a secure gaming platform will also offer transparent terms and conditions, fair wagering requirements, and a responsive customer support team. Wagering requirements dictate how many times a bonus amount must be wagered before it can be withdrawn. Lower wagering requirements are generally more favorable to players. Efficient and helpful customer support is crucial for resolving any issues or concerns that may arise. Look for casinos that offer multiple support channels, such as live chat, email, and phone support. Identifying and Addressing Problem Gambling
Problem gambling can manifest in various ways, including chasing losses, gambling with money intended for essential expenses,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, it's important to seek help immediately. Numerous resources are available, including self-exclusion programs, support groups, and counseling services. Organizations like GamCare and BeGambleAware offer confidential support and guidance. Remember, se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ness. Taking proactive steps to address problem gambling is essential for protecting both financial and emotional well-being.
- Set a Budget: Determine how much money you can afford to lose.
- Set Time Limits: Limit the amount of time you spend gaming.
- Avoid Chasing Losses: Don’t try to win back lost money by betting more.
- Don’t Gamble Under the Influence: Avoid gambling when you are stressed, tired,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
- Take Breaks: Regularly step away from gaming to clear your head.
Implementing these strategies can help maintain a healthy relationship with online gaming and prevent it from becoming a problem.

Navigating the Regulatory Landscape and Protecting Player Interests
The regulatory framework surrounding online gaming is complex and varies significantly across different jurisdictions. The intent of regulation is to protect player interests, prevent fraud and money laundering, and ensure fair gaming practices. Staying informed about the legal requirements in your region is essential for both players and operators. Increasingly, regulators are focusing on responsible gaming measures, requiring operators to implement tools and safeguards to prevent problem gambling. This includes features like de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and reality checks.
Proactive regulatory oversight is crucial for fostering a sustainable and trustworthy online gaming environment. Collaboration between regulators, operators, and industry stakeholders is vital for addressing emerging challenges and protecting the integrity of the industry. Ultimately, a robust regulatory framework benefits everyone involved, ensuring a fair, safe, and enjoyable experience for players and promoting responsible growth for the industry.
